Udostępnij za pośrednictwem


ICorProfilerCallback4::GetReJITParameters — Metoda

Umożliwia profilerowi kodu ustawianie flag generowania kodu alternatywnego dla nowej ponownie skompilowanej treści metody.

Składnia

HRESULT GetReJITParameters(     [in] ModuleID moduleId,     [in] mdMethodDef methodId,     [in] ICorProfilerFunctionControl *pFunctionControl);  

Parametry

moduleID
[in] Moduł zawierający metodę, dla której clR wymaga parametrów ponownej kompilacji JIT.

methodId
[in] Metoda MethodDef , dla której clR wymaga parametrów ponownej kompilacji trybu JIT.

pFunctionControl
[in] Wskaźnik do interfejsu ICorProfilerFunctionControl , którego profiler może użyć do zapewnienia informacji o ponownym kompilowaniu JIT dla metody, która jest ponownie skompilowana.

Uwagi

ClR wystawia GetReJITParameters wywołanie zwrotne, aby profiler mógł określić parametry ponownego kompilowania danej metody. Wywołanie GetReJITParameters zwrotne jest wystawiane tylko raz na funkcję; parametry dostarczone przez profilera mają zastosowanie do wszystkich wystąpień tej funkcji.

Wymagania

Platformy: Zobacz Wymagania systemowe.

Nagłówka: CorProf.idl, CorProf.h

Biblioteki: CorGuids.lib

wersje .NET Framework: dostępne od wersji 4.5

Zobacz też